NEWS 5.18.21: Mask Changes, Farmers to Families Food Giveaway, Derailment Cleanup, and More


SPM NEWS 5.18.21
Iowa school districts are reviewing their policies on mask wearing after the Iowa Department of Public Health issued new guidance late last week.
However, several major school district, including Sioux City are still requiring them.
The Department of Public Health says masks should be optional and that kids exposed to COVID-19 should not have to stay home.
That’s in conflict with the CDC which says masking and quarantine should continue until more adults and children are vaccinated.
Starting today Hy-Vee no longer requires fully vaccinated customer and employees to wear face covering in stores, unless it’s required by local ordinances. That’s according to a news release issued by the grocery. It goes on to day face coverings continue to be strongly recommended for customers who are not fully vaccinated. Walmart and Target also announced vaccinated customers and employees no longer need to wear masks. ....

NEWS 5.7.21: C19 Deaths, IA Health Spending, Perkins Incident Update, and More


SPM NEWS 5.7.21
The Iowa Department of Public Health added 18 more deaths due to complications of COVID-19, and almost 400 new cases with three in Woodbury County.
The number of deaths and cases may not have occurred during the past 24-hours as the state does add backdated information.
Currently there are almost 190 people hospitalized in the state with the virus with five patients being treated in Sioux City.
The 14-day test positivity rate statewide is 3.8%, in Woodbury County the level is 3.5%.

NEWS 4.28.21: C19 Vaccinations, IA Broadband Boost, SD Medical Marijuana Update, and More

The Iowa Department of Public Health shows three more deaths due to complications of COVID-19 and more than 500 new cases, including seven more in Woodbury County. Since the start of the pandemic more than 15,000 Woodbury County residents have tested positive for the virus and 224 deaths.
The 14-day test positivity rate in Woodbury County is 4.1%, this is slightly above the state rate of 4%.

The Dakota County Health Department announced plans for a public vaccination clinic in South Sioux City tomorrow. The clinic is scheduled for 2 to 6 p.m. at El Ranchito on Cornhusker Drive. The clinic is open to residents of both Nebraska and Iowa. Pre-registration is recommended, but not required. To sign up go to vaccinate.ne.gov. ....
